Adjustment – Fifth Wheel Slide
Mechanism

1. Loosen lock nut and turn adjustment

bolt out (counter-clockwise).

2. Disengage and engage the locking

plungers. Verify that plungers have

seated properly as shown.

3. Now tighten adjustment bolt until it

contacts the rack.

4. Turn the adjustment bolt clockwise an

additional 1/2 turn, then tighten the

lock nut securely.

5. If plungers do not release fully to

allow fifth wheel to slide:

a. Check the air cylinder for proper

operation. Replace if necessary.

b. Check plunger adjustment, as

explained above.

c. If a plunger is binding on the

plunger pocket, remove the plunger

using a Holland TF-TLN-2500

spring compressor. Grind the top

edges of the plunger 1/16˝ as

shown. Re-install and adjust the

plungers, as explained above.

Proper adjustment of the
locking plungers must be

performed at regular intervals and is
required for proper operatiion, load
transfer and distribution.

6. If the locking plungers are too loose:

a. Check plunger adjustment, as

explained above.

b. Check plunger springs for proper

compression. Replace if necessary.

c. Check for plunger wear. If

necessary, replace, as described

above.

After inspection and adjustment, relubricate
all moving parts with a light, rust resistant
oil.
